Restoration Techniques
The restoration procedure can vary based on the handle's product. Below are some popular materials and their corresponding methods:
1. Metal HandlesCleaning up: Use a soft fabric moistened with soapy water to remove dirt and gunk. For tarnished metal, a mix of vinegar and baking soda can be efficient. Polishing: For brass or chrome handles, use metal polish to bring back shine. Buff with a soft cloth for an attractive finish.Rust Removal: For rusty iron handles, sand the rust off utilizing fine-grit sandpaper, followed by a coat of rust-inhibiting paint.2. Wooden HandlesSanding: Begin by sanding down rough areas, followed by finer grit to smooth the surface.Staining: Apply a wood stain to improve the door handle's color. Clean away excess to avoid uneven coloration.Sealing: Use a wood sealant or varnish to protect the handle from future wear and damage.3. Plastic HandlesCleaning: Use warm, soapy water and a soft fabric. Avoid abrasive cleaners that can scratch plastic surfaces.Buffing: For scratches, a plastic polish can help restore clearness and shine.Tools and Supplies Needed for Restoration

Begin by getting rid of the door handles. Utilize a screwdriver to remove any screws securing the handle in location.
Action 2: Clean Thoroughly
Pick a suitable cleansing technique based on the handle material. Guarantee to eliminate all dirt, grease, and residue.
Action 3: Assess Damage
After cleansing, evaluate each handle for any damage, consisting of rust on metal or fractures in wood. Identify the suitable restoration technique needed based on this assessment.
Step 4: Restore
Follow the techniques described above based upon the product type. Make sure to use any discolorations or polishes equally.
Step 5: Reassemble and Install
When brought back, thoroughly reassemble your door handles. Ensure that all screws are tight and functional.
Action 6: Maintenance
Finally, maintain your handles by regularly dusting and cleaning them, which can prolong their life and aesthetic appeal.
